What exactly Does Final Expense Insurance Cover?
Your funeral expenses are covered by burial insurance as you could have guessed from your name. This includes obvious things like purchasing your final resting place, buying the coffin (or cremation costs), paying for your own funeral service, and purchasing a headstone.
Other lesser known prices that may often be covered are things like grave digging and floral arrangements. They are not large on their own, however they can add up fast.
For an unprepared family who might not have a lot of disposable income, these costs (which can run into the tens of tens of thousands of dollars) can be quite a jolt. How Much Final Expense Insurance Cost?
So as we hope you will concur by this time, protecting your family from these unforeseen and large costs is a thing that ought to be considered near essential. Death is unavoidable, it’s very much a case of “when” not “if”.
Costs for burial insurance strategies differ radically between providers. Some basic coverage plans can begin from just a couple dollars a week, however there are highly complete strategies that cost more.
You can find policies that provide coverage up to $50k although the policies typically provide coverage between $5000 and $25,000 but on Better coverage demands higher fees yet as you can imagine.
Most payments are created monthly, however there are several strategies that accept weekly payments also.
The sum you should pay is mainly decided by your age. The old you are, the more your premiums are going to be. If you’re mathematically closer to passing, you are going to should cover more over a shorter quantity of time, it’s simple economics really. Due to their lifespans that are statistically shorter, men often cover more for final expense insurance than women.
This is one of the reasons that many individuals strongly counsel that you take out interment insurance early on. A lifetime of almost unnoticeably small payments is superior to trying to make fewer larger payments when you are frequently relying on a pension for income.

Your health also plays a big role in your premiums. If you have a history of serious health issues, your premium will be greater. It’s beneficial to understand that insurance companies that are different have different standards. So should you have health issues, it pays to search around.
There is going to be a large difference in quality between insurers, so do your research and see which provider provides you with an ideal balance between coverage and price.
